WebJun 28, 2024 · To set your screen’s resolution: Choose Start→Control Panel→Appearance and Personalization and click the Adjust Screen Resolution link. The Screen Resolution window appears. Click the arrow to the right of the Resolution field and use the slider to select a higher or lower resolution. Click OK. The new screen resolution is accepted. WebFeb 8, 2024 · To change the settings of a specified display device, use the ChangeDisplaySettingsEx function. Note Apps that you design to target Windows 8 and later can no longer query or set display modes that are less than 32 bits per pixel (bpp); these operations will fail. These apps have a compatibility manifest that targets Windows 8.
